π Course Description: Dive into the transformative world of gene editing with our comprehensive online course, designed to equip you with a foundational understanding of one of the most groundbreaking advancements in biotechnology.
𧬠What You'll Learn:
- The Gene Editing Landscape: Get acquainted with the key players in gene editing β Zinc Finger Nucleases (ZFN), Transcription Activator Like Effector Nucleases (TALEN), and the CRISPR Cas9 system, with a deep dive into CRISPR's versatility and power.
- Innovative Techniques: Uncover the mechanisms behind cutting-edge gene editing technologies like Base Editing and Prime Editing, and understand their applications in genetic engineering.
- Specialized Applications: Learn about Mitochondrial Gene Editing and how it's revolutionizing treatments for mitochondrial diseases.
- Ethical Considerations: Engage with the ethical implications of gene editing through a compelling case study, sparking thought-provoking discussions on the societal impact of these technologies.
